首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用PyGithub仅返回问题

PyGithub是一个用于与GitHub API交互的Python库。它提供了一组简单易用的方法和类,用于访问和操作GitHub上的仓库、分支、提交、问题、拉取请求等。

PyGithub的主要功能包括:

  1. 访问仓库信息:可以获取仓库的基本信息,如名称、描述、所有者等。可以获取仓库的分支列表、标签列表、提交记录等。
  2. 创建和删除仓库:可以使用PyGithub创建新的仓库,并设置仓库的名称、描述、私有性等属性。也可以删除已存在的仓库。
  3. 访问问题(Issues):可以获取仓库中的问题列表,包括已关闭和未关闭的问题。可以获取问题的标题、内容、创建时间、状态等信息。还可以创建新的问题、编辑已存在的问题、关闭和重新打开问题。
  4. 访问拉取请求(Pull Requests):可以获取仓库中的拉取请求列表,包括已合并和未合并的请求。可以获取请求的标题、内容、创建时间、状态等信息。还可以创建新的拉取请求、编辑已存在的请求、合并和关闭请求。
  5. 访问提交记录(Commits):可以获取仓库中的提交记录列表,包括每个提交的作者、提交时间、提交信息等。可以获取提交的具体内容、修改的文件等信息。
  6. 访问仓库的文件和目录:可以获取仓库中的文件和目录结构,包括每个文件的名称、路径、大小等信息。可以获取文件的具体内容、修改文件内容等。
  7. 访问仓库的分支和标签:可以获取仓库中的分支列表和标签列表,包括每个分支和标签的名称、创建时间、最后提交等信息。
  8. 访问仓库的贡献者和团队:可以获取仓库的贡献者列表和团队列表,包括每个贡献者和团队的名称、角色等信息。
  9. 其他功能:PyGithub还提供了其他一些功能,如访问仓库的关注者、订阅者、访问仓库的统计信息等。

PyGithub的优势在于它提供了一个简单易用的接口,使得与GitHub API的交互变得非常方便。它封装了底层的HTTP请求和认证过程,提供了一组高级的方法和类,使得开发者可以更加专注于业务逻辑的实现,而不需要关注底层的细节。

PyGithub的应用场景包括但不限于:

  1. 自动化仓库管理:可以使用PyGithub创建、删除、编辑仓库,管理仓库的分支、标签、问题、拉取请求等。
  2. 数据分析和可视化:可以使用PyGithub获取仓库的提交记录、问题列表等数据,进行数据分析和可视化展示。
  3. 自动化构建和部署:可以使用PyGithub获取仓库的文件和目录结构,自动化构建和部署应用程序。
  4. 团队协作和项目管理:可以使用PyGithub管理团队成员的权限,协作开发项目。

腾讯云提供了一系列与GitHub相关的产品和服务,可以与PyGithub结合使用,例如:

  1. 代码托管服务:腾讯云提供了代码托管服务,可以创建私有仓库、管理代码版本、协作开发等。具体产品介绍和链接地址请参考:腾讯云代码托管
  2. 云开发平台:腾讯云提供了云开发平台,可以快速构建和部署应用程序。具体产品介绍和链接地址请参考:腾讯云云开发
  3. 云函数:腾讯云提供了云函数服务,可以将代码部署为无服务器函数,实现自动化任务和事件驱动的应用程序。具体产品介绍和链接地址请参考:腾讯云云函数

请注意,以上只是腾讯云提供的一些与GitHub相关的产品和服务,其他云计算品牌商也提供类似的产品和服务,具体选择应根据实际需求和预算来决定。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

WordPress免插件代码实现“返回顶部、返回底部、评论”效果(样式一)

本文所说的”返回顶部、返回底部、评论 “相信你知道是什么东东了吧?  一般你在各大网站的右下角都能看到类似的东东,但许多网站都普遍只有“返回顶部”的效果。...本站将陆续发表几篇文章提供这几类“返回顶部、返回底部、评论”的添加方法(教程 ),今天提供的是在Jeff的阳台中使用的,效果如下: ? ? 你也可以到Jeff的阳台查看效果。...此“返回顶部、返回底部、评论”效果没有像本站使用的js滑动特效,但影响不大。如果你在意这个,你也可以等待后续文章更新。具体的黑色是通过css定义的,你可以改成你需要的颜色。...div id="sticky-nav"> 返回顶部...建议将下载的这个gif图片使用CSS sprite与其他图片合并,以减少http请求数。

1.3K70

返回栈空间地址 问题

当我们返回栈空间地址时会报错,为什么呢?那让我们先看一下什么是返回栈空间地址? 下面是错误示范: vs2022版演示  出现问题,不要慌,那我们就先调试一下。...正好str也是一个指针,正好接收地址,再打印str 按理来说没什么问题啊,但为什么会打印 烫烫烫烫烫烫烫烫呢?...那有同学会问,如果返回的不是地址,是一个变量,能不能这样做呢?...答案是肯定哒,yes  上面就是栈空间地址问题的讲解,总结一下简单可以理解为,函数调用如果返回值为一个局部地址,就会出错,除非返回变量,或加上static修饰。...另外加一个知识点,如果空间是在堆区上开辟的,堆区只有  free来释放空间,所以不存在返回占栈空间地址问题

11720

SpringMVC配置Tomcat返回406问题探索

@ResponseBody返回String没有问题返回POJO与Map等页面报406错误 ApplicationAware类报NPE错误 其他与具体项目相关的错误 尝试过的解决办法:...2、3是首先解决的,因为是具体项目相关的东西,在此不多说,主要说下1 1:Google了一下Tomcat 406问题,Stackoverflow(问题地址 有很多个,大家可以自行搜索,这里只贴一个)上说缺少...,于是只能debug代码,看spring对相应的类型是如何做转换的了 在controller方法返回后,spring会对请求与可提供的类型转换做匹配,代码如下: protected void writeWithMessageConverters...因为 是会自动配置一些Converter还有其他的东西的,但是以前自己曾经的项目中貌似没有问题,抱着不能错过的态度搜了一下<mvc:annotation-driven...registerWithGeneratedName(handlerMappingDef); 注意这行 handlerMappingDef.getPropertyValues().add("order", 0); 至此问题解决

1.1K30

read函数的返回问题

Read函数读取字符串返回值的问题 1. 前言 在学习socket编程的途中, 通过客户端给服务端发送字符串,然后服务端通过read或者recv来读取数据,然后返回读取的字节数....我在想read返回的读取字节数有没有包含'\0'或者'\n'呢,于是通过一些简单的小例子,来看看实际情况到底如何. 2. read函数 我们来看一下read函数的原型: ssize_t read(int...大概的意思就是read函数从文件描述符fd中读取字节到count大小的buf中,如果成功读取的话,返回读到的字节数大小,否则返回-1....buf: 6 注意在代码中 printf("Read buf: %s", buf); 这一句我是没有加换行符的,但是输出的时候却有了换行的作用,说明buf把换行符'\n'给读取进来了,下面的长度也说明了问题...strlen返回的字符串长度都是5,验证了这一点. 5.

2.6K10

session.save()返回问题

正常都应该返回插入的主键 但是 如果你用sessionFactory来写就一定返回0 先科普下持久化数据库的三个状态方便下面理解 一次会话状态中,持久化对象经历以下三种状态: 1 transient:对象不与数据库中任意数据相关联...3 detached(脱管、游离状态) 因为 使用getCurrentSession来创建session的话 在commit后 session就自动被关闭了 也就是不用再session.close()了...但是如果使用的是sessionFactory的openSession方法创建的session的话 那么必须显示的关闭session 也就是调用session.close()方法 这样commit后...//使用saveOrUpdate方法的话,如果对象处于临时状态的话会进行插入,如果是脱管状态的话会更新。...//反过来说,临时态主键就是0,所以sessionFactory的返回值一定是0!

81410

byteTCC框架--关于接口返回问题的讨论

在普通的web项目中,调用接口返回数据,如下,不出错返回一种,出错了,返回另外一种。前端是直接可以拿到返回的信息的。...关于这个问题的处理,请教了下byteTCC的维护者,非常耐心的回答了关于这个问题的疑问。...你这种做法不是不可以,只是说:在参与事务处理的controller中这样做不可以,不参与事务处理的controller中这样做是没问题的。...HTTP接口,成功时200返回码就可以;返回4xx/5xx时就是失败了。...在框架层面封装,而不是在controller中做这个事情 comsumer的接口,也不需要显式的返回信息,直接void,没问题就成功了,有问题的话,页面调用这个接口时,会直接拿到某种异常信息,判断下即可

98630
领券